## Runbook: Cold starts — Quillhook handlers

Quillhook's serverless handlers cold-start when idle past the provider's reap window, typically after quiet overnight hours. Symptoms: p99 latency spikes on the first request per region, sometimes gateway timeouts on the heavier export handlers. We mitigate with provisioned concurrency on the three hot paths and a warming ping every four minutes elsewhere. If spikes persist, check that the warmer job is running before escalating. The relevant settings for the warmer and concurrency pools are these.

deployment values, yadug-bawif:
[framir]
team = pelox
access_code = ac_a38ab2
owner = tamion.julael
host = framir.tolvaqlabs.test
port = 11211
peer = tammir.zemvargrid.local
salt = 2215ef03
pin = 1541

Lost-badge procedure — facilities desk

When a staff member reports a lost badge at Wrenfield Court, first deactivate the badge in the Gatewright panel and record the time in the incident log. Issue a paper day pass valid until 18:00 and remind the holder it does not open secure floors. A replacement badge takes two working days. If the person needs the secure corridor on Level 1 in the meantime, give them the code below.

staff pass of kawip-hawef = bdg-QLP-2

### Escalation

So the Quillgate proctoring queue is backing up — here's the drill. First, check queue depth on the Marrowfield dashboard; under 5k jobs, just let autoscaling catch up. Over 5k, or if exams are actively stalling, page the on-call via the rotation tool and drop a note in the incident channel. Don't drain or purge anything solo — those jobs are live exam sessions and losing them means manual remediation. If the on-call doesn't ack within 15 minutes, escalate straight to the platform leads at the address below.

alerts address for yajof-kahog: eliax@qirvanlabs.corp